New Employee - Initial Probationary Period. New employees to the District, or past employees who have not been in service to the District for over thirty-nine (39) months shall be subject to an initial probationary period of twelve (12) months, and considered probationary employees. A probationary employee may be dismissed for any reason, at the sole discretion of the District.
